Output 031786173a80564673ef8a22c97ad66d0d7e89942e78b810b168cb36c8dc012f:0

value
116525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0ee3fcc5d334fdd41ec53827363e21aee801f90 OP_EQUAL
address
3PewWRonxNq4RLMa6bHPNDM84SsL7uJMxr
transaction
031786173a80564673ef8a22c97ad66d0d7e89942e78b810b168cb36c8dc012f
spent
true